I have a noob question, when a car is running, does it still need a battery/electric charge?

The thing is my car can suddenly died when I drive it and I took it to a shop and the tech has replaced some parts and it still did not work :(

Now when I start it I have to start and hold the key half way to get the car running... if I let it go it just died..

Once a vehicle is running it no longer requires the battery to stay running other than to complete the electrical circuit. Older vehicles could run with out a battery. Newer vehicles it would not be wise to try running without a battery.

BTW, it sounds like you have a classic ignition switch failure.
